<description>&#60;p&#62;We had this problem with my daughter - she was always a heavy overnight wetter but once we transitioned to 2 piece PJs, she would push the waist of her pants down and it caused all sorts of diaper fit problems.   It was a phase we just have to live through.  What ultimately helped the most is having her pee on the potty right before bed - even when we weren’t actually potty training.   She was ok with it because her older sister had to do it too  :wink:  I know he’s super young, but maybe try that?

<description>&#60;p&#62;My 18 month old started regularly soaking through overnight diapers several months ago. He is already in the size 6, so I’ve tried adding a sposie diaper liner. It worked ok for a while but lately he’s been soaked through more mornings than not and I’m constantly washing crib sheet and sleep sacks.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;We were using up&#38;amp;up (target) overnights, and when those ran out recently I bought huggies to see if that might help, but I think it’s actually worse.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;What’s the next step? Is there a next step?
